The fabric required to Gavin to make the outside of the replica, including the "floor" is 136 in²
What is surface area?
Surface area of any solid or the 3 dimensional body is the area of each faces by which the solid body is enclosed.
Surface area of  triangular prism with isosceles triangle base is find out using the following formula,
[tex]A_s=[(2a+b)\times l]+2\times A_b[/tex]
Gavin is making a scale replica of a tent for his social studies project.
The replica is in the shape of a triangular prism. It has an isosceles triangle base with side lengths 6 inches, 5 inches, and 5 inches.
The base area of the prism is,
[tex]A=\dfrac{1}{2}\sqrt{5^2-\dfrac{6^2}{4}}{\times6}\\A=12\rm\; in^2[/tex]
The height of the triangle is 4 inches, and the depth of the tent is 7 inches.
Put the values in the above formula as,
[tex]A_s=[(2\times5+6)\times 7]+2\times12\\A_s=136\rm \; in^2[/tex]
Thus, the fabric required to Gavin to make the outside of the replica, including the "floor" is 136 in².
